Double-Blind Peer Review
To maintain impartial evaluation and intellectual merit, all submissions undergo a rigorous double-blind peer review process. In this model, both the reviewer and author identities are concealed from each other throughout the review period.
Reviewers are selected based on their specific expertise in the subject matter. Each manuscript is typically evaluated by at least two independent subject matter experts. Our editors ensure that reviewers have no conflicts of interest related to the research under consideration.
Confidentiality
Manuscripts are treated as confidential documents during the review process.
Timeframe
Typical review cycles range from 4-8 weeks to ensure depth and accuracy.

ABSU Journals operates under a gold open-access model. We believe that knowledge should be barrier-free and accessible to the global scientific community immediately upon publication.
"Articles are licensed under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International (CC BY 4.0)."
Plagiarism Policy
We maintain a zero-tolerance policy regarding plagiarism. Every submission is rigorously screened using Turnitin and other advanced similarity detection tools.
Manuscripts with a similarity index exceeding 15% (excluding citations and references) are subject to immediate desk rejection without further appeal.
